David George Stead (1877-1957), naturalist, was born on 6 March 1877 at St Leonards, Sydney, sixth child of English-born Samuel Leonard Stead, house-painter, and his Scottish wife Christina, née Broadfoot. Despite his mother's strictness, he had a happy childhood: the sea, the shoreline and the bush were his early loves.
